“I Am Not Hospitalized” After World Cup – Maradona by Tmicheals123(m): 11:35am On Jun 27, 2018
An Argentine retired professional footballer and manager, Diego Maradona was regarded as the greatest football player of all time. Maradona was joint FIFA Player of the 20th Century says he is fine after sparking a health scare following Argentina’s dramatic late win against Nigeria that saw them progress to the last 16 of the World Cup.

Maradona had been visibly emotional during the match in Saint Petersburg, which Argentina had to win to stay in the tournament.

He leaned over the front of the VIP box from where he was watching with friends and made an obscene gesture after Marcos Rojo scored a late winner.

“I want to tell everyone that I am fine, that I am not and was not hospitalized,” the 57-year-old wrote on Instagram on Wednesday.

A video emerged showing the 1986 World Cup winner looking dazed.

He walked with difficulty and was guided into the dining room of the VIP section by two friends before sitting down in a chair.

“At half-time against Nigeria, my neck hurt a lot and I suffered a drop in my blood pressure,” he said.

“I was checked by a doctor and he recommended that I go home before the second half, but I wanted to stay because we were risking it all,” he wrote.
